A flexible role-based access control (RBAC) library with zone-based permissions using efficient bitfield operations

Readme

access-zones

A flexible, high-performance role-based access control (RBAC) library with zone-based permissions using efficient bitfield operations.

npm version TypeScript License: MIT

Features

  • Role Aggregation: Combine multiple roles with OR logic for flexible inheritance
  • High Performance: Bitfield operations for O(1) permission checking
  • Zone-Based: Organize permissions by functional areas (content, users, admin, etc.)
  • Type-Safe: Full TypeScript support with comprehensive type definitions
  • Zero Dependencies: No runtime dependencies
  • Database-Agnostic: Works with any database or ORM

Quick Start

import {
  checkPermission,
  assertAccess,
  PERMISSION_MASKS
} from 'access-zones';

// Define user roles with zone-based permissions
const userRoles = [
  {
    id: 'editor',
    name: 'Content Editor',
    access: {
      content: PERMISSION_MASKS.CREATE | PERMISSION_MASKS.READ | PERMISSION_MASKS.UPDATE,
      users: PERMISSION_MASKS.READ
    }
  }
];

// Check if user can update content
const canEdit = checkPermission(
  { content: PERMISSION_MASKS.UPDATE },
  userRoles
); // true

// Assert permissions (throws AccessControlException if insufficient)
assertAccess({ content: PERMISSION_MASKS.READ }, userRoles);

Core Concepts

Permission Masks

Permissions use bitfield operations for maximum efficiency:

import { PERMISSION_MASKS } from 'access-zones';

PERMISSION_MASKS.ADMIN   // 0b10000 (16) - Admin permission
PERMISSION_MASKS.CREATE  // 0b01000 (8)  - Can create new items
PERMISSION_MASKS.READ    // 0b00100 (4)  - Can read/view items
PERMISSION_MASKS.UPDATE  // 0b00010 (2)  - Can modify items
PERMISSION_MASKS.DELETE  // 0b00001 (1)  - Can delete items

Combine permissions with bitwise OR:

// Read + Update permissions
const editorPermissions = PERMISSION_MASKS.READ | PERMISSION_MASKS.UPDATE; // 6

// All CRUD permissions
const allCrud = PERMISSION_MASKS.CREATE | PERMISSION_MASKS.READ |
                PERMISSION_MASKS.UPDATE | PERMISSION_MASKS.DELETE; // 15

// Full permissions including admin
const fullPermissions = allCrud | PERMISSION_MASKS.ADMIN; // 31

Access Zones

Zones represent functional areas of your application:

const role = {
  id: 'moderator',
  name: 'Moderator',
  access: {
    content: PERMISSION_MASKS.ADMIN,      // Full access to content
    users: PERMISSION_MASKS.READ,          // Can view users
    billing: 0                             // No access to billing
  }
};

Role Aggregation

When a user has multiple roles, permissions are combined using OR logic:

import { collapseRoles } from 'access-zones';

const roles = [
  { id: '1', name: 'Viewer', access: { content: PERMISSION_MASKS.READ } },
  { id: '2', name: 'Editor', access: { content: PERMISSION_MASKS.UPDATE } }
];

const combined = collapseRoles(roles);
// { content: 6 } - READ (4) | UPDATE (2)

API Reference

Permission Checking

checkPermission(needed, roles)

Check if roles satisfy the required permissions.

import { checkPermission, PERMISSION_MASKS } from 'access-zones';

const roles = [{ id: '1', name: 'Editor', access: { content: 6 } }];

checkPermission({ content: PERMISSION_MASKS.READ }, roles);   // true
checkPermission({ content: PERMISSION_MASKS.DELETE }, roles); // false

assertAccess(needed, roles)

Assert permissions, throwing AccessControlException if insufficient.

import { assertAccess, PERMISSION_MASKS } from 'access-zones';

try {
  assertAccess({ content: PERMISSION_MASKS.DELETE }, roles);
} catch (error) {
  // AccessControlException: Not authenticated
}

assertDataAccess(data, needed, user)

Check access to a specific data item, considering ownership.

import { assertDataAccess, PERMISSION_MASKS } from 'access-zones';

const data = { userId: 'user-123' };
const user = { id: 'user-123', roles: [], access: {} };

// Returns true - user owns the data
assertDataAccess(data, { content: PERMISSION_MASKS.UPDATE }, user);

Role Management

collapseRoles(roles)

Combine multiple roles into a single permission set using OR logic.

import { collapseRoles } from 'access-zones';

const permissions = collapseRoles(userRoles);
// { content: 14, users: 4 }

normalizeRole(role) / normalizeRoles(roles)

Transform roles from database format to normalized format.

import { normalizeRole } from 'access-zones';

const dbRole = {
  id: '1',
  name: 'Editor',
  access: [
    { zone: { id: 'z1', name: 'content' }, permission: 6 }
  ]
};

const normalized = normalizeRole(dbRole);
// { id: '1', name: 'Editor', access: { content: 6 } }

userHasRole(user, roleName)

Check if a user has a specific role.

import { userHasRole } from 'access-zones';

userHasRole(user, 'Admin');      // true/false
userHasAnyRole(user, ['Admin', 'Editor']);  // true if any match
userHasAllRoles(user, ['Admin', 'Editor']); // true if all match

Bitfield Utilities

toBitField(permission) / fromBitField(bitField)

Convert between permission objects and bitfields.

import { toBitField, fromBitField } from 'access-zones';

const bitField = toBitField({ create: true, read: true, update: false, delete: false });
// 12 (CREATE | READ)

const permission = fromBitField(12);
// { create: true, read: true, update: false, delete: false }

hasPermission(bitField, mask)

Check if a bitfield includes a specific permission.

import { hasPermission, PERMISSION_MASKS } from 'access-zones';

hasPermission(6, PERMISSION_MASKS.READ);   // true (6 = READ | UPDATE)
hasPermission(6, PERMISSION_MASKS.DELETE); // false

combinePermissions(...bitFields)

Combine multiple permission bitfields.

import { combinePermissions, PERMISSION_MASKS } from 'access-zones';

const combined = combinePermissions(
  PERMISSION_MASKS.READ,
  PERMISSION_MASKS.UPDATE
); // 6

Zone Utilities

getUserZones(user)

Get all zones a user has any permissions for.

import { getUserZones } from 'access-zones';

getUserZones(user); // ['content', 'users', 'admin']

getUserZonesWithPermission(user, permissionType)

Get zones where user has a specific permission.

import { getUserZonesWithPermission } from 'access-zones';

getUserZonesWithPermission(user, 'create'); // ['content']
getUserZonesWithPermission(user, 'read');   // ['content', 'users']

Item-Level Access

getUserPermissions(user, item, zoneKey)

Get user's permissions for a specific item, considering item-level access settings.

import { getUserPermissions } from 'access-zones';

const item = {
  uid: 'owner-123',
  settings: {
    access: {
      global: PERMISSION_MASKS.READ,  // Everyone can read
      users: [
        { uid: 'special-user', access: PERMISSION_MASKS.ADMIN }
      ]
    }
  }
};

getUserPermissions(user, item, 'content');
// Returns Permission object based on ownership, user-specific, or global settings

Database Integration

The library is database-agnostic. Here's an example with a typical schema:

// Your database models can have any additional fields
const dbRole = {
  id: 'role-1',
  name: 'Editor',
  description: 'Can edit content',  // Extra field - ignored by RBAC
  createdAt: new Date(),            // Extra field - ignored by RBAC
  access: [
    { zone: { id: 'z1', name: 'content' }, permission: 6 }
  ]
};

// Normalize for RBAC operations
const role = normalizeRole(dbRole);
// { id: 'role-1', name: 'Editor', access: { content: 6 } }

Security

The library includes multiple layers of security protection:

Bitfield Validation

All permission bitfields are validated to prevent:

  • Negative numbers (e.g., -1 which has all bits set)
  • Values exceeding 32-bit limit
  • Non-integer values (floats, NaN, Infinity)
  • Type coercion attacks (strings, booleans, objects)

Zone Name Validation

Zone names are validated to prevent prototype pollution and method override attacks:

// These zone names are REJECTED:
'__proto__'      // Prototype pollution
'constructor'    // Constructor override
'toString'       // Method override
'_internal'      // Underscore prefix
'settings_'      // Underscore suffix
''               // Empty string

Null-Prototype Objects

Permission objects use Object.create(null) internally to prevent prototype chain attacks.

Validation Functions

import {
  isValidZoneName,
  validateZoneName,
  isValidBitField,
  validateBitField,
  createSafeObject
} from 'access-zones';

// Check if a zone name is valid
isValidZoneName('content');     // true
isValidZoneName('__proto__');   // false

// Validate with exception
validateZoneName('content');    // OK
validateZoneName('__proto__');  // throws AccessControlException

// Create safe objects for your own use
const safeObj = createSafeObject<Record<string, number>>();

Error Handling

The library throws AccessControlException for permission failures:

import { assertAccess, AccessControlException } from 'access-zones';

try {
  assertAccess({ admin: PERMISSION_MASKS.ADMIN }, userRoles);
} catch (error) {
  if (error instanceof AccessControlException) {
    console.log(error.status);  // 'unauthorized'
    console.log(error.message); // 'Not authenticated'
  }
}
